IBM Trusteer Pinpoint Detect, helps protect digital channels against account takeover, fraudulent transactions, and can detect end user devices infected with high risk malware. Trusteer Pinpoint Detect is a cloud-based solution that can transparently build user profiles and continuously authenticate online identities to more efficiently differentiate between a true user and fraudsters. It is designed to enable a real-time risk assessment with an actionable recommendations, employ behavioral biometrics capabilities to seamlessly build models based on patterns of mouse movements in real-time and analyze patterns against learned user behavior and known fraud patterns, identify access using compromised credentials and provide actionable recommendations to help detect and mitigate fraudulent activities and control and create custom policies to help you rapidly build and deploy countermeasures leveraging machine learning and advanced analytics.
Issuers and merchants rely on the 3-D Secure (3DS) protocol in the fight against “card-not-present” (CNP) fraud. You may recognize brands such as Mastercard SecureCode®, Verified by Visa, American Express SafeKey® and Discover ProtectBuy—all of which are 3DS implementations.
Pindrop Protect provides a risk score and call intelligence to the call center in the first few seconds of each call. The risk score - along with the analysis of the caller’s voice, device, and behavior - is provided to the call center’s fraud analyst team for further investigation. Pindrop’s proprietary machine learning algorithms then use feedback from the investigation to maximize solution performance.
